Although the most popular method of printing t-shirts is screen printing; Crooked Brook t-shirts are printed using Direct to Garment Printing (DTG printing or digital garment printing) which is the process of using inkjet printers to print an image directly onto a t-shirt without the use of screens like screen printing. Direct to Garment Printing uses eco-friendly, water soluble ink, unlike some screen printing methods that layer Plastisol (a suspension of PVC particles in a plasticizer) on top of the t-shirt. In addition, Crooked Brook’s direct to garment inks are among the first direct to garment inks to not only carry the Oeko-Tex Certification, but also be CPSIA compliant to help ensure they are safe for printing on youth garments.
